Broadcast has reported that Carlton Productions has acquired the rights to another incarnation of the "Who wants to..." format; a show where the prize is a date with a Page Three girl.
Carlton is understood to have created the snappily-titled "Who Wants to Date a Page Three Girl?" following the purchase of rights to the format of US show, "Who Wants to Date a Hooters Girl?". The company is believed to be pitching to UK broadcasters, including the ITV network, home of Who Wants To Be a Millionaire.
The US version of the show, which aired on NBC, featured contestants competing with each other for a date with a waitress from US bar chain, Hooters. The tagline of the show was "where the guy gets a girl and all the girls get a laugh." It is possible, although unconfirmed at the present time, that Carlton may choose to partner with The Sun for the UK version, the tabloid newspaper being the home of the Page Three Girl.
